Casigliano
A fabulous opportunity to choose a favourite ruin from this forgotten estate in an unspoilt part of Umbria and turn it into a dreamy house fit for the 21st century
The ruins at Casigliano are made up of the former homes of those who worked the fields on this breathtakingly beautiful estate. Available to purchase individually, the ruins are set apart from each other and thus each one is guaranteed absolute privacy. United by the incredible view and their extraordinary potential, but marked out by their own particularities, you can visit them all before choosing your favourite.

The Casigliano estate sits in a vast and ancient landscape characterised by farmland, woodland and ancient buildings. This unspoilt part of South Umbria retains an authentic charm, coupled with extraordinary beauty.
